クラス UpdateMapper
java.lang.ObjectSE
org.springframework.data.r2dbc.query.QueryMapper
org.springframework.data.r2dbc.query.UpdateMapper
Update
をマップして割り当てを更新する QueryMapper
のサブクラス。- 作成者:
- Mark Paluch
ネストされたクラスのサマリー
クラス org.springframework.data.r2dbc.query.QueryMapper から継承されたネストクラス / インターフェース
QueryMapper.Field, QueryMapper.MetadataBackedField
コンストラクターの概要
コンストラクターコンストラクター説明UpdateMapper
(R2dbcDialect dialect, R2dbcConverter converter) 指定されたR2dbcConverter
で新しいQueryMapper
を作成します。メソッドのサマリー
修飾子と型メソッド説明getMappedObject
(BindMarkers markers, MapSE<SqlIdentifier, ? extends ObjectSE> assignments, Table table, RelationalPersistentEntity<?> entity) getMappedObject
(BindMarkers markers, Update update, Table table, RelationalPersistentEntity<?> entity) クラス org.springframework.data.r2dbc.query.QueryMapper から継承されたメソッド
convertValue, getBindValue, getMappedObject, getMappedObject, getMappedSort, getMappingContext, toSql
コンストラクターの詳細
UpdateMapper
指定されたR2dbcConverter
で新しいQueryMapper
を作成します。- パラメーター:
dialect
- null であってはなりません。converter
- null であってはなりません。
メソッドの詳細
getMappedObject
public BoundAssignments getMappedObject(BindMarkers markers, Update update, Table table, @Nullable RelationalPersistentEntity<?> entity) - パラメーター:
markers
- バインドマーカーオブジェクト。null にすることはできません。update
- 定義をマップに更新します。null であってはなりません。table
- null であってはなりません。entity
- 関連するRelationalPersistentEntity
は、null にすることができます。- 戻り値:
- マップされた
BoundAssignments
- 導入:
- 1.1
getMappedObject
public BoundAssignments getMappedObject(BindMarkers markers, MapSE<SqlIdentifier, ? extends ObjectSE> assignments, Table table, @Nullable RelationalPersistentEntity<?> entity) - パラメーター:
markers
- バインドマーカーオブジェクト。null にすることはできません。assignments
- マップする定義を更新 / 挿入します。null であってはなりません。table
- null であってはなりません。entity
- 関連するRelationalPersistentEntity
は、null にすることができます。- 戻り値:
- マップされた
BoundAssignments